  16. HadesR

    Info I received in convo with a Dev about the issue

    Hello,

    To clarify the changes:
    • There are different speed stats for when the weapon is locked on and for when it isn't. The projectile speed if fired while locked on is unchanged.
    • The rocket doesn't accelerate anymore if fired without a lock.
    So the end result is that the weapon should perform exactly like before if used in the GTA role. The dumbfire rocket speed was intentionally slowed down, we thought this was a better change then completely removing the ability to fire without a lock.

    Which from my own testing seems inaccurate .. " should perform " and " does perform " are two diff things though
